Camp Invention Returns to Lincoln Academy!In partnership with Invent Now Kids, Lincoln Academy is pleased to offer the nationally-acclaimed, weeklong Camp Invention program at Lincoln Academy to children entering grades one through six. This exciting summer day experience immerses children in imaginative play that reinforces and supplements school-year learning through inquiry-based activities in science, technology, engineering, and math (STEM). Each day of the program week, children rotate through five integrated modules that require creative thinking to solve real-world challenges. Working together, children learn vital 21st century life skills such as problem-solving and teamwork through hands-on learning… disguised as fun! This exciting week of activities begins on June 14 when Sarah Jacobson will direct the Camp Invention INNOVATE program. Children will be challenged to rebuild a virtual world and act as entrepreneurs as they establish a new marketplace in the Hatched™ module, explore alternative energy to power their robotic creatures in the Power’d™ module, and discover surprising mathematical connections between soap bubbles and lightening bolts in the SMArt: Science, Math & Art™ module. As with every Camp Invention program, the INNOVATE program will feature the I Can Invent III™ module, where younger children will take apart discarded household appliances and create fantasy inventions, while older children will use the pieces and parts to build Rube Goldberg machines. Also featured will be the Global Games™ module, where children will explore ancient cultures and sports like lacrosse and soccer from civilizations around the world. Local educators will facilitate the program modules, and enthusiastic high school and college students will serve as program counselors. This renowned program features a low staff-to-child ratio, with one staff member for every eight children. The registration fee includes a Camp Invention T-shirt.
